'Drive through a scenic countryside South of Manila to a unique place called Hidden Valley.
It's bewitching vegetation flourishes in a 110-hectare crater 300 feet deep believed to have been formed by a violent volcanic upheaval thousands of years ago.
A private resort that boasts of virgin forests, century old trees, giant ferns, wild orchids, and a hidden waterfall which is a sight to behold.
Several natural spring pools are available for dipping to guarantee a well day spent. Meals include Buffet Lunch and Afternoon Snacks (Merienda).'
